Antibody response and therapy in COVID-19 patients:what can be learned for vaccine development?

The newly emerged severe acute respiratory syndrome coronavirus 2(SARS-CoV-2)has infected millions of people and caused tremendous morbidity and mortality worldwide.Effective treatment for coronavirus disease 2019(COVID-19)due to SARS-CoV-2 infection is lacking,and different therapeutic strategies are under testing.Host humoral and cellular immunity to SARS-CoV-2 infection is a critical determinant for patients'outcomes.SARS-CoV-2 infection results in seroconversion and production of anti-SARS-CoV-2 antibodies.The antibodies may suppress viral replication through neutralization but might also participate in COVID-19 pathogenesis through a process termed antibody-dependent enhancement.Rapid progress has been made in the research of antibody response and therapy in COVID-19 patients,including characterization of the clinical features of antibody responses in different populations infected by SARS-CoV-2,treatment of COVID-19 patients with convalescent plasma and intravenous immunoglobin products,isolation and characterization of a large panel of monoclonal neutralizing antibodies and early clinical testing,as well as clinical results from several COVID-19 vaccine candidates.In this review,we summarize the recent progress and discuss the implications of these findings in vaccine development.
